The Holiday Slipover is a chunky slipover with a deep armhole. The Holiday Slipover is worked from the top down in stockinette stitch. First the back is worked, then the shoulders and front and finally the body. At the bottom of the body, a two-part rib edge is worked, where the back piece is worked longer than the front rib edge. Finally, ribbing is worked along the neck opening and armholes and finished with an Italian bind-off for a beautiful, finished look.Make a swatch before you start. Note that you knit with three strands (two of the thick yarn and one strand of silk mohair).Size guideThe Holiday Slipover should have a movement space (positive ease) of approximately 6 cm in relation to your chest measurement. Sizes XS (S) M (L) XL (2XL) 3XL (4XL) 5XL correspond to chest measurements of 80-85 (85-90) 90-95 (95-100) 100-110 (110-120) 120-130 (130-140) 140-150 cm. Measure yourself before you start knitting to assess which size will fit you best. For example, if you measure 90 cm around your chest (or the widest part of your body), you should knit a size S, which has a width of 96 cm. S that has an overall width of 96 cm. This will give you a room to move (positive ease) of 6 cm in this example.If you want a more oversized fit, you can go up one size from your normal size.Sizes: XS (S) M (L) XL (2XL) 3XL (4XL) 5XLThe target of the slipover: Overall width: 92 (96) 102 (106) 116 (126) 136 (146) 156 cmBack width at top incl. ribbing: 36 (36) 37 (39) 42 (43) 44 (44) 46 cmArmhole depth: 27 (27) 28 (29) 30 (31) 31 (33) 34 cmLength centre back: 56 (57) 58 (59) 60 (62) 63 (63) 64 cm measured centre back incl. neck ribKnitting tension: 10 stitches x 14 rows in stockinette stitch on a 10 mm needle with two strands of the thick yarns and one strand of silk mohair knitted together = 10 x 10 cm after washing and blockingGuiding sticks: 10 mm circular needle (60, 80 or 100 cm), 9 mm circular needle (40 and 60 cm)

The No Frills Sweater is a simple raglan sweater with a front neckline. The fit is slightly oversized, but the wide ribbed edges and slightly shorter length give the sweater a feminine cut. The No Frills Sweater is knitted from the top down, so it's recommended that you try the sweater on to get the right length of sleeves and body for you. If you want to keep the neck edge tight, you can sew a thin elastic thread along the rib edge.Size guideThe No Frills Sweater should have a room to move (positive ease) of approximately 15 cm in relation to your chest measurement. Sizes XS (S) M (L) XL (2XL) 3XL correspond to chest measurements of approximately 80-85 (85-90) 90-95 (95-100) 100-110 (110-120) 120-130 cm. The measurements of the finished sweater are given on the front of the pattern (note that these measurements only apply if the gauge is followed). Measure yourself before you start knitting to estimate your size. Example: You measure yourself with a tape measure around your chest (or stomach if it's the widest part of your body) to 93 cm. This means that you should knit a size M. A size M sweater has a width of 108 cm. M sweater has an overall width of 108 cm and will in this example provide a room to move (positive ease) of 15 cm.Sizes: XS (S) M (L) XL (2XL) 3XLSpan: 100 (104) 108 (114) 120 (130) 137 cmCentre back length: 52 (54) 55 (56) 58 (60) 62 cmKnitting tension: 21 stitches x 28 rows in stockinette stitch on 4 mm needles = 10 x 10 cmGuiding sticks: 3 mm and 4 mm circular needles (40 cm and 80 or 100 cm), 3 mm and 4 mm double-pointed needles

Jenny Jacket is worked from the bottom up in smock knit. The body and sleeves are worked separately, then joined on the same circular needle and the yoke is worked. The yoke is finished at the top with short rows to form the neckline. The body is worked back and forth while the sleeves are worked in the round on double-pointed needles or with Magic Loop-technique. Finally, pick up stitches along the front edges and knit button plackets. Then knit the neck edge.Size guideJenny Jacket should have a room to move (positive ease) of approximately 12-15 cm in relation to your chest measurement. Sizes XS (S) M (L) XL (2XL) 3XL (4XL) correspond to a chest measurement of 80-85 (85-90) 90-95 (95-100) 100-105 (105-115) 115-125 (125-135) cm. The measurements of the finished cardigan are given on the front of the pattern. Measure yourself before you start knitting to assess which size will fit you best. For example, if you measure 90 cm around your chest (or the widest part of your body), you should knit a size S. A cardigan in size S. S cardigan has an overall width of 102 cm and will, in this example, provide a room to move (positive ease) of 12 cm. If you are between two sizes, it is recommended to choose the smaller size, as the smocking knit will grow slightly in use.Sizes: XS (S) M (L) XL (2XL) 3XL (4XL)The width of the jacket: 97 (102) 107 (113) 118 (123) 134 (145) cmLength: 52 (52) 53 (59) 61 (61) 64 (64) cmKnitting tension: Smocking pattern: 30 stitches x 25-26 rows on a 4 mm needle in two strands Sunday and one strand Thin Silk Mohair = 10 x 10 cm after washing and blockingRib stitch: 28 stitches x 27 rows on a 3.5 mm needle in two strands Sunday and one strand Thin Silk Mohair = 10 x 10 cmGuiding sticks: 3.5 mm and 4 mm circular needles (60, 80 and 100 or 120 cm); 3.5 mm and 4 mm double-pointed needles (if sleeves are not worked with Magic Loop-technology)

The Jenny Sweater is worked in the round from the bottom up in smock knit with raglan decreases. The body and sleeves are worked separately, then joined on the same circular needle and the yoke is worked. The neck is worked back and forth on the needle and the neckline is shaped by continuously casting off stitches. The neck edge is knitted on at the end from the picked up stitches.Knit a test swatch to check your gauge before you start.Size guideJenny Sweater should have a room to move (positive ease) of approximately 19 cm in relation to your chest measurement. Sizes XS (S) M (L) XL (2XL) 3XL (4XL) correspond to a chest measurement of 80-85 (85-90) 90-95 (95-100) 100-110 (110-120) 120-130 (130-140) cm. The measurements of the finished sweater are given on the front of the pattern. Measure yourself before you start knitting to assess which size will fit you best. For example, if you measure 90 cm around your chest (or the widest part of your body), you should knit a size S. A size S sweater is a size S. S sweater has a width of 109 cm and will, in this example, provide a room to move (positive ease) of 19 cm. If you are between two sizes, it is recommended to choose the smaller size, as the smock knit will grow slightly in use.Sizes: XS (S) M (L) XL (2XL) 3XL (4XL)Span: 104 (109) 114 (119) 129 (139) 149 (158) cmLength: 61 (62) 63 (63) 65 (67) 69 (70) cm measured centre back including neck edgeKnitting tension: Smock knit pattern: 30-31 stitches x 25-26 rows on 4 mm needles = 10 x 10 cm after washing and blockingRib stitch (k2, p1): 25 stitches x 27 rows on 3.5 mm needles = 10 x 10 cmGuiding sticks: 3.5 mm and 4 mm circular needles (40, 60, 80 and 100 or 120 cm); 3.5 mm and 4 mm double-pointed needles (if sleeves are not worked with Magic Loop-technology)

Christmas sock is worked from the shaft down towards the toe. The sock is worked in stockinette and the heel is shaped with short rows. The sock is felted at the end before a leather strap is attached.Sizes: one sizeMeasure before felting: Width: 22 cmShaft length: 40 cmLength of foot: 30 cmMeasurements after felting: Width: 17 cmShaft length: 34 cmLength of foot: 26 cmKnitting tension: 15 stitches x 21 rows in stockinette stitch on 5.5 mm needles = 10 x 10 cmGuiding sticks: 5.5 mm circular needle (40 cm), 5.5 mm double-pointed needles (or an 80 cm circular needle if you knit with Magic Loop-technology)
